Skellings, Edmund – Perspectives in Computing: Applications in the Academic and Scientific Community, 1983
Describes The Electric Poet, a computer program which uses color graphics to free the poet from mundane mechanics and allow new possibilities of form in writing verse. Its applications in working with hearing impaired and learning disabled students and use in studying works of the great poets are discussed. (MBR)

Porter, Gerald J. – Collegiate Microcomputer, 1984
Presents the options and limitations available in microcomputer-based graphic systems. Factors that must be considered when selecting a system--resolution, color, video-compatibility, and cost--and the relationship between these factors are discussed. (MBR)
